Compartir comentarios
Las respuestas se generan en base a la documentación.

Endpoints de la API de Docker Hub depreciados

Esta página proporciona una descripción general de los endpoints que están depreciados en la API de Docker Hub.

Política de depreciación de endpoints

A medida que se realizan cambios en Docker, puede haber ocasiones en las que sea necesario eliminar los endpoints existentes o reemplazarlos por otros más nuevos. Antes de eliminar un endpoint existente, se etiqueta como "depreciado" dentro de la documentación. Después de un tiempo, puede ser eliminado.

Endpoints depreciados

La siguiente tabla proporciona una descripción general del estado actual de los endpoints depreciados:

Depreciado: el endpoint está marcado como "depreciado" y ya no debe ser utilizado.

El endpoint puede ser eliminado, deshabilitado o cambiar su comportamiento en una versión futura.

Eliminado: el endpoint fue eliminado, deshabilitado u ocultado.



Depreciar los CreateRepository y GetRepository heredados

Depreciar endpoints no documentados:


Depreciar el ListNamespaceRepositories heredado

Depreciar el endpoint no documentado GET /v2/repositories/{namespace} reemplazado por Listar repositorios.


Crear la tabla de registro de depreciaciones

Reformatear página


Depreciación de la API v1 de Docker Hub

La API v1 de Docker Hub ha sido depreciada. Usa la API v2 de Docker Hub en su lugar.

Las siguientes rutas de la API dentro de la ruta v1 ya no funcionarán y devolverán un código de estado 410:

  • /v1/repositories/{name}/images
  • /v1/repositories/{name}/tags
  • /v1/repositories/{name}/tags/{tag_name}
  • /v1/repositories/{namespace}/{name}/images
  • /v1/repositories/{namespace}/{name}/tags
  • /v1/repositories/{namespace}/{name}/tags/{tag_name}

Si deseas seguir utilizando la API de Docker Hub en tus aplicaciones actuales, actualiza tus clientes para usar los endpoints v2.